If there is one thing summer is truly famous for, its mangoes. This tropical treat is known for its irresistible sweetness and aroma. But mango is not just the king of fruits, it is also one of the most important commodities in international trade. Did you know that mango ranks as the fifth most consumed fruit in the world, following citrus, bananas, grapes, and apples? It is considered the national fruit in several countries, including India, Pakistan, the Philippines, and Haiti. With its various flavor profiles, thousands of known varieties, and rich nutritional value, mango is among the most traded tropical fruits globally. As a supplier, understanding the mango market, evolving demand patterns, and quality standards is key to running a profitable export business.
There are thousands of mango varieties, but the most sought-after ones include Alphonso, Kesar, Kent, Haden, Tommy Atkins, Sindhri, Chausa, Francis, Ataulfo, and Keitt. The international trade market for mangoes has seen significant growth in past years. It is due to rising consumption across regions like Europe, North America, Asia-Pacific, and the Middle East. There are a number of factors responsible for this growing demand. The most important one is that this fruit offers both exotic taste and health benefits. We all know that mangoes are rich in antioxidants, dietary fiber, and vitamin C, and this makes them popular in health-conscious diets. In addition, mangoes can be consumed in various ways. People can consume it directly or use it as an ingredient in both savory and sweet dishes. Beyond culinary uses, mangoes also have medicinal purposes as different parts of the mango tree are used in traditional medicine. Moreover, it is often used in the skincare industry as mango pulp is known to moisturize the skin and soothe sunburns.

Apart from these qualities, mango importers may require adherence to specific food safety standards as well as phytosanitary and environmental certifications (such as amfori BSCI). Also, make sure to follow packaging and labeling norms. In the case of mangoes, usually single-layer boxes (wooden crates and corrugated fiberboard) are considered for packaging based on weight, ripeness, and classification.

2. What is the rate of mango per kg?
Though price depends on mango types, origin, and grade, the average 1 kg mango price today may range between $0.60/kg to $5.95/kg.
3. Who is the biggest importer of mangoes?
The United States is the biggest importer of mangoes worldwide.
4. Which country is the largest consumer of mangoes?
India is the largest consumer of mangoes. Moreover, India is also one of the biggest producers and significant exporters of mangoes.
5. Which countries import mango from India?
There are many countries that import mangoes from India. The major ones include the UAE, Nepal, the UK, Oman, Saudi Arabia, Kuwait, the USA, and Qatar.

7. What is the HS code for fresh mangoes?
080450 is the HS code for fresh mangoes.
